Why Roanoke's Heavy Humidity and Rural Dust Strain Your Climate Systems

The Toll of High Moisture on Cooling Equipment

The most common issue we see in local homes is premature cooling equipment failure caused by our relentless ambient humidity. When the air remains thick with moisture, your system's compressor has to work overtime just to remove the dampness before it can even begin lowering the actual temperature inside your living spaces. This continuous, heavy workload inevitably leads to electrical burnout, frozen evaporator coils, and unexpectedly high energy bills that drain your budget.

Without proper professional oversight, this high-moisture environment forces your equipment to run constantly and drastically shortens its overall operational lifespan. The resulting mechanical wear and tear means internal components break down much faster than they would in drier, more temperate climates. We routinely assess residential systems that have been pushed to their absolute limits simply because they were never properly calibrated for our specific regional weather patterns.

Heat Pump Challenges in Older Brick Ranches

During periods of sudden temperature drops, we frequently respond to calls about heat pumps struggling to defrost or completely failing to keep up with the changing weather. Many older brick ranches and traditional historic homes near the city center lack modern insulation, meaning your equipment has to run constantly to combat the damp, penetrating chill. This constant cycling puts immense mechanical stress on moving parts and frequently leads to unexpected system shutdowns when you need warmth the most.

Our local housing stock heavily relies on these dual-purpose units, making proper calibration and precise airflow management absolutely critical for maintaining indoor comfort. When a unit is forced to operate continuously in an older, drafty home, the reversing valve and compressor endure severe operational fatigue that compromises efficiency. Upgrading structural efficiency and fine-tuning these units ensures they can actually handle the unique demands of our demanding local environment.

The Hidden Dangers of Leaky Ductwork

Beyond just pulling in dust, compromised ductwork severely limits the overall efficiency and cooling capacity of your central climate control system. Conditioned air escapes into your attic or walls before it ever reaches your bedrooms, forcing your main unit to run twice as long to achieve the desired thermostat setting. This hidden energy waste is a primary reason why so many homeowners experience hot and cold spots throughout different rooms in their house.

Identifying these unseen leaks requires a trained eye and a thorough understanding of how air pressure interacts with older architectural layouts. We utilize advanced diagnostic techniques to pinpoint exactly where your system is losing pressure and implement permanent structural corrections. Resolving these airflow bottlenecks immediately improves your daily comfort while significantly reducing the operational strain on your primary machinery.

Managing Indoor Humidity for Better Comfort

Achieving true indoor comfort requires more than just lowering the ambient temperature; it demands precise control over the invisible moisture levels trapped inside your home. When indoor humidity remains unchecked, your living spaces will feel perpetually sticky, and your wooden fixtures may even begin to warp or degrade over time. Implementing whole-house moisture control solutions ensures that your environment feels crisp, clean, and perfectly balanced regardless of the muggy conditions outside.

Standalone room dehumidifiers are often insufficient for tackling the sheer volume of moisture that permeates homes throughout our specific region. We integrate high-capacity moisture management systems directly into your existing ductwork to provide seamless, invisible protection for your entire property. This comprehensive approach fundamentally transforms how your home feels while simultaneously protecting your valuable interior assets from long-term moisture damage.
